Hong Kong Airlines confirms order for 25 new Airbus planes

14 Oct 2010

Hong Kong Airlines has confirmed orders for 25 Airbus aircraft that would expand its present Airbus fleet to 33.

The US$5.7-billion order, which was first announced in July at the Farnborough International Airshow, includes 15 Airbus A350 and 10 A330-200 aircraft. They will be used on the airline's long-haul services to Europe and North America, which are currently being developed. At present, the Hong Kong Airlines' route network spans China, Japan, Taiwan, Vietnam and Russia.

Delivery of the first A330-200s will begin in 2012, with the new A350 coming in from 2018. The carrier also has another 30 A320 single-aisle aircraft on firm order for future delivery.
